Blade Material Quality

Choosing the right blade material is essential because it directly impacts a knife’s sharpness, durability, and ease of maintenance. High-quality Japanese knives often feature steels like VG-10, AUS-8, or 10Cr15Mov, known for their hardness and edge retention. Damascus steel, with layered patterns, not only looks stunning but also offers enhanced durability and corrosion resistance. The steel’s HRC hardness rating, usually between 60-62, indicates how well the blade maintains its sharpness over time. Many traditional knives incorporate multiple layers of steel, combining softer core steel with tougher outer layers for ideal performance. Keep in mind, harder steels require more careful sharpening but tend to keep their edge longer. Choosing the right steel ultimately balances performance, maintenance, and longevity.

Blade Sharpness & Edge

The sharpness of a traditional Japanese knife heavily depends on its edge angle and honing technique, which directly influence cutting performance. Typically, these knives have a micro-bevel and precise angles around 15°, making them sharper than Western counterparts with 20°-30° angles. Some high-quality knives even feature nearly zero-degree bevels, resulting in ultra-fine, razor-sharp edges ideal for delicate slicing. The steel’s hardness—usually between 60-62 HRC—also plays a vital role in maintaining sharpness over time. Proper sharpening methods, such as water stones, create a smooth, durable edge that enhances performance. Ultimately, narrower angles and fine micro-structures enable cleaner, more effortless cuts, especially on fragile ingredients, making edge sharpness a key factor when choosing a Japanese knife.

What Maintenance Is Required for High-Carbon Steel Japanese Knives?

High-carbon steel Japanese knives need regular maintenance to stay sharp and rust-free. I always hand wash mine immediately after use, dry thoroughly, and occasionally oil the blade with food-safe oil to prevent corrosion. Sharpening is vital—use a whetstone regularly to keep the edge precise. Avoid dishwasher cleaning, and store the knife properly in a sheath or knife block to prevent damage. Proper care ensures your knife stays in top condition.

How Do Different Blade Shapes Influence Cutting Techniques?

Different blade shapes dramatically influence cutting techniques. A gyuto’s curved blade allows smooth rocking motions, perfect for slicing vegetables and meats. A yanagiba’s long, narrow form excels at precise, thin cuts, ideal for sashimi. A deba’s thick, heavy blade is perfect for breaking down fish, while a petty knife’s small, versatile shape is great for detailed work. Choosing the right shape helps you work efficiently and achieve professional results.
